Reconditioning is often an excellent alternative to purchasing a new machine. Many machines from quality manufacturers have a long service life due to their robust construction, and reconditioning can extend their life by several more years.

Our factory is fully equipped for machine reconditioning. An action plan is drawn up prior to the start of the project and is planned together with the customer. A reconditioning project is carried out in roughly the following phases:

Action Plan/Planning
Dismantling and loading at the customer’s site
Transportation to our plant
Dismantling into basic machine
Cleaning of the entire machine
Ice blasting of the entire machine
Painting of the machine frame
Inspection of each machine part
Repair and replacement of necessary parts
Installation of new parts (counters, bearings, belts, etc.)
Black painting of rust-prone parts
Assembly
Trial run
Fine tuning
Final test in the presence of the customer
Preparation for disassembly and loading
Transportation to customer
Unloading and installation at the production site
Machine installation
